Canvas - Manipulating Basic Shapes - Resize, Weld and Subtract

As it's December, I thought it'd be a fun introduction to Canvas to learn how to make a basic flat bauble shape with a hanging hole. This creates a simple shape that is one single pattern. Once made it can be resized, and the hanging hole is an integral part of the pattern.

We cover - choosing basic shape, duplicate, weld, subtract and resize with this one.
